Symone Degraft Case Study
Symone Degraft-Amanfu
BA Education and Childhood Studies
“Why did you choose to study at Anglia Ruskin University?
I decided to study at Anglia Ruskin University because I thought it would be a good place to study as it is not too far from home. I also liked the facilities.
What initially attracted you to the course?
I was attracted by the placement abroad. Having an opportunity to study in a different setting will give me a chance to learn new skills and meet new people.
Which aspects of your course do you enjoy most and why?
I enjoy the coursework. There was no exams so I was quite happy about that. I was good at sociology and the course also covers most of the sociological concepts.
Why would you recommend the course to others?
The course has met my expectations as I have learnt and am still learning everything I thought I was going to need. It has helped me deal with the key issues in Education and how chilldren learn. It's also a good way to get on to the PGCE primary as I plan to become a primary school teacher.
How do you rate our facilities and resources on offer at our campuses?
The facilities come in handy. The sports facilities are very efficient and they have a lot to offer. The library resources are good too. Facilities I have found useful during my studies are the Virtual Learning Environment, Evision and the library.
